determine all combinations of lengths that vould be usef to for a traingle 4,6,12,16 and also another lengths of 8,10,14,17

Answers

Answer:

[tex]\lbrace 6,\, 12,\, 16 \rbrace[/tex].

[tex]\lbrace 8,\, 10,\, 14 \rbrace[/tex],

[tex]\lbrace 8,\, 10,\, 17\rbrace[/tex],

[tex]\lbrace 8,\, 14,\, 17 \rbrace[/tex], and

[tex]\lbrace 10,\, 14,\, 17 \rbrace[/tex].

Step-by-step explanation:

In a triangle, the sum of the lengths of any two sides must be strictly greater than the length of the other side. In other words, if [tex]a[/tex], [tex]b[/tex], and [tex]c[/tex] (where [tex]a,\, b,\, c > 0[/tex]) denote the lengths of the three sides of a triangle, then [tex]a + b > c[/tex], [tex]a + c > b[/tex], and [tex]b + c > a[/tex].

Additionally, if [tex]a,\, b,\, c > 0[/tex], [tex]a + b > c[/tex], [tex]a + c > b[/tex], and [tex]b + c > a[/tex], then three line segments of lengths [tex]\text{$a$, $b$, and $c$}[/tex], respectively, would form a triangle.

 

Number of ways to select three numbers out of a set of four distinct numbers:

[tex]\begin{aligned} \left(\begin{matrix}4 \\ 3\end{matrix}\right) &= \frac{4!}{3! \, (4 - 3)!} \\ &= \frac{4 \times 3 \times 2 \times 1}{(3 \times 2 \times 1) \times (1)} \\ &= 4\end{aligned}[/tex].

In other words, there are four ways to select three numbers out of a set of four distinct numbers.

For [tex]\lbrace 4,\, 6,\, 12,\, 16\rbrace[/tex], the four ways to select the three numbers are:

[tex]\lbrace 4,\, 6,\, 12\rbrace[/tex],[tex]\lbrace 4,\, 6,\, 16\rbrace[/tex], [tex]\lbrace 4,\, 12,\, 16\rbrace[/tex], and[tex]\lbrace 6,\, 12,\, 16\rbrace[/tex].

Among these choices, [tex]\lbrace 6,\, 12,\, 16\rbrace[/tex] satisfies the requirements: [tex]6 + 12 > 16[/tex], [tex]16 + 6 > 12[/tex], and [tex]12 + 16 > 6[/tex]. Thus, three line segments of lengths [tex]\lbrace 6,\, 12,\, 16\rbrace\![/tex] respectively would form a triangle.

The other three combinations do not satisfy the requirements. For example, [tex]\lbrace 4,\, 6,\, 12\rbrace[/tex] does not satisfy the requirements because [tex]4 + 6 < 12[/tex]. The combination [tex]\lbrace 4,\, 12,\, 16\rbrace[/tex] does not satisfy the requirement for a slightly different reason. Indeed [tex]4 + 12 = 16[/tex]. However, the inequality in the requirement needs to be a strict inequality (i.e., strictly greater than "[tex]>[/tex]" rather than greater than or equal to "[tex]\ge[/tex]".)

Thus, [tex]\lbrace 6,\, 12,\, 16\rbrace[/tex] would be the only acceptable selection among the four.

Similarly, for [tex]\lbrace 8,\, 10,\, 14,\, 17 \rbrace[/tex], the choices are:

[tex]\lbrace 8,\, 10,\, 14 \rbrace[/tex], [tex]\lbrace 8,\, 14,\, 17 \rbrace[/tex], [tex]\lbrace 8,\, 10,\, 17 \rbrace[/tex], and[tex]\lbrace 10,\, 14,\, 17 \rbrace[/tex].

All four combinations satisfy the requirements.

Marina is building a triangular sandbox for her daughter. If she has two boards that measure 3ft and 7.25ft, which of the following lengths could Marina use for the third side of the triangular sandbox

Answers

Marina could use for the third side of the triangular sandbox the option: C - 7.25 ft.

Triangle Inequality Theorem

In mathematic, there is a rule for triangle side lengths. This rule says that the sum of the lengths of any two sides of a triangle is greater than the length of the one side (third side).  Therefore,

                                       [tex]L_1+L_2 > L_3\, (1)\\ \\ L1+L_3 > L_2\, (2)\\ \\ L_2+L_3 > L_1\, (3)[/tex]

The question gives two sides: 3 ft (L1) and 7.25 ft (L2), applying the equation (1) of rule for triangle side lengths, you have:

                                          [tex]L_1+L_2 > L_3\\ \\ 3+7.25 > L_3\\ \\ 10.25 > L_3\\ \\ L_3 < 10.25[/tex]

The options for answer are: 4.25ft, 10.25ft,  7.25ft and 3ft. According to triangle inequality [tex]L_3 < 10.25[/tex], hence, the letter B is not the answer.

After that, you can apply equations (2) or (3) for testing the options. For solution below, it was used the equation (2).

Test 1  - 3 ft (L1) , 7.25 ft (L2) and 4.25 ft (L3)

                                 [tex]L_1+L_3 > L_2\\ \\ 3+4.25 > L_2\\ \\ 7.25 > L_2\\ \\ L_2 < 7.25[/tex]

The second side is exactly equal to 7.25, according to the rule this side should be less than 7.25. Therefore, the option 4.25 ft is not the answer.

Test 2  - 3 ft (L1) , 7.25 ft (L2) and 7.25 ft (L3)

                                 [tex]L_1+L_3 > L_2\\ \\ 3+7.25 > L_2\\ \\ 10.25 > L_2\\ \\ L_2 < 10.25[/tex]

The question informs that the second side is 7.25 ft. Then 7.25 < 10.25, so the option 7.25 ft is the answer.

You can continue to test the last option, but it is not necessary since you have already found the corrected answer.

Test 3  - 3 ft (L1) , 7.25 ft (L2) and 3 ft (L3)

                                 [tex]L_1+L_3 > L_2\\ \\ 3+3 > L_2\\ \\ 6 > L_2\\ \\ L_2 < 6[/tex]

The second side is equal to 7.25, hence, the option 3 ft is not the answer.
